Overview

From the back of the book:

Of all the armies of the Inner Sphere, none is as universally feared and respected as that of House Kurita's Draconis Combine. With fighting skills learned in the finest academies and tempered by the ancient code of bushido, the MechWarriors of the DCMS know no equals. Their loyalty and skill are legendary, and their tenacity has won them hundreds of battles across known space. This classified field manual, seized from the Combine's Internal Security Force, reveals the inner workings of the Draconis Combine military, from district regular units to the elite Sword of Light regiments. This document is an invaluable resource for both allies and enemies of the Combine.

Battletech Field Manual: Draconis Combine contains extensive information about all aspects of House Kurita's military. Every BattleMech regiment of the DCMS is described in detail, including their history, officers and tactics, special rules reflecting the unique abilities of each regiment are included as an optional expansion to BattleTech play. Among the many other features of the book are new weapons, equipment, and BattleMechs unique to the Draconis Combine.

User comment:

The most detailed and expansive sourcebook for matters relating to House Kurita and the Draconis Combine since the House Kurita sourcebook ten years earlier, this BattleTech expansion features much more by way of rules and game material than it's predecessor, and provides detail on every major 'Mech unit in serice with the Combine at the time. This sourcebook is currently out of print.
